Holiday Tax Threatens Family Trips, Warns Butlin's and Hilton

Story summary
  • The proposed 'holiday tax' would expose British holidaymakers to about a £100 increase for a two-week trip.
  • Butlin’s and Hilton have urged the Chancellor to abandon the levy, warning it would harm families and reduce spending in local communities.
  • The proposal would let regional mayors impose visitor levies to boost funding for local infrastructure.
  • A government spokesperson said any new charges would be modest and support local economies.
